The Newport Beach City Municipal Code 17.60.030 states:
C.4. Prior to the transfer of an annual pier permit, all harbor structures shall be
inspected for compliance with the City’s minimum plumbing, electrical and structural
requirements, and the conditions of the existing permit. All structural deficiencies must
be corrected prior to the transfer of the permit. A fee will be charged for this inspection,
established by Resolution of the City Council.

In accordance with Title 17 of the California Administrative Code, all piers and docks must have
an approved backflow prevention device installed on the water supply line serving that pier or
dock. The purpose of the device is to protect the domestic water system from being
contaminated by seawater or by “used” water from boat holding tanks. It is also required that
this device be tested annually.
You are therefore, required to install an approved Reduced Pressure Principle Backflow Device
downstream of the water meter, landward of the bulkhead or hide tide line. The size of the
device should match the size of the supply line, typically ¾” or 1” but sometimes larger.
